Understanding the Role of a Conservatory Contractor
A conservatory contractor specializes in the design, construction, and installation of conservatories. Their competence encompasses various elements, consisting of:
- Design Consultation: They work with homeowners to understand their vision and recommend designs that fit their visual and functional needs.
- Preparation Permission: They assist in acquiring required licenses and guarantee that the construction complies with local regulations.
- Material Selection: They assist in picking appropriate materials, such as glass, framework (uPVC, aluminum, or wood), and roofing choices.
- Construction: They deal with the actual building procedure, making sure that it is finished to a high requirement.
- Post-Installation Services: Many specialists offer maintenance or aftercare services to make sure the conservatory remains in peak condition.

While choosing a conservatory contractor, it is important to be cautious of the following risks:
- Choosing Based on Price Alone: The lowest quote isn't constantly the best. Consider the quality of work and products.
- Not Checking References: Always act on references supplied by the contractor.
- Disregarding Contracts: Ensure all information remain in writing, consisting of timelines, costs, and guarantees.
The Conservatory Design Process
When you have actually picked a contractor, the design process can begin. This usually involves numerous key actions:
- Initial Consultation: Meeting with the contractor to talk about concepts and requirements.
- Website Assessment: Evaluating the existing space and its viability for a conservatory.
- Design Proposal: The contractor provides a design proposal, frequently consisting of sketches or 3D renderings.
- Product Selection: Choosing the proper materials for the frame, glass, and components.
- Last Approval: Once the design and products are approved, the construction phase can start.

FAQs About Conservatory Contractors
Q1: How much does it cost to build a conservatory?A: The cost of a conservatory differs depending upon size, products, and intricacy of the design. Typically, expenses can vary from ₤ 15,000 to ₤ 50,000. Q2: How long does it require to build a conservatory?A: Generally, the construction of a conservatory can take anywhere from a few weeks to a number of months, depending upon the size and design. Q3: Do I require preparing approval for a conservatory?A: Many conservatories fall under' permitted development,'suggesting they do not require preparation permission. Nevertheless, this can depend on local regulations, so it's best to seek advice from with your contractor.
